How Partisan Voters Dispense Reward and Punishment for Government Performance: The Influence of Partisan Blame Attribution on Trust in Government (당파적 유권자는 정부의 국정 운영에 대해 어떻게 문책하는가?: 정부의 국정 운영 평가와 정부 신뢰, 그리고 당파적 책임 귀속)

  • Voters' negative evaluations of government performance lower their trust in government, which functions as the reward and punishment for the government. Trust in government thus serves to promote political accountability of the representative government. However, voters build their confidence toward the party government where the ruling party is responsible for the performance. Considering this partisan nature, we empirically examine that the influence of voters' performance evaluations on governmental trust is conditional on their party identifications. While higher perceptions of political/social conflict and increasing negative evaluations of government policies and economic performance are associated with the lower level of confidence in government, the relationship is contrasted between different party identifiers. For supporters of the ruling party in 2020, the negative evaluations of government performance are not likely to reduce trust in government a lot. On the contrary, those who identify with the main opposition party show the most prominent effect of negative evaluations on their distrust in government. This study demonstrates that trust in government is affected by voters' partisan preferences, not entirely by evaluations of government performance. Such a distortion of the reward and sanction function of governmental trust might lead to the weakening of the accountability mechanism in representative democracy.

A Analysis on the Present State and Character of Game Regulation in Korea (게임 부문 규제 현황 및 특성 분석: 규제개혁위원회 등록 규제에 대한 게임 정책 신뢰에 대한 소고)

  • There are a lot of game regulations in Korea. Each scholar has invested a game regulation. But there is no research about all the game regulations. All regulations in government should be registered in Regulatory Reform Committee. So, this study researched the all game regulation in Regulatory Reform Committee and found the present state and character of game regulation in Korea. The registered game regulations are only 22. But actually, there are 44 regulations in game field. And according to legal context, there are over 60 regulations in game field. And a lot of game regulations focus on the game addiction and gambling. The differences of regulation would influence the policy trust and government trust. This result would contribute to reform the regulation of game in Korea.

Linkage Expansion in Linked Open Data Cloud using Link Policy (연결정책을 이용한 개방형 연결 데이터 클라우드에서의 연결성 확충)

  • This paper suggests a method to expand linkages in a Linked Open Data(LOD) cloud that is a practical consequence of a semantic web. LOD cloud, contrary to the first expectation, has not been used actively because of the lack of linkages. Current method for establishing links by applying to explicit links and attaching the links to LODs have restrictions on reflecting target LODs' changes in a timely manner and maintaining them periodically. Instead of attaching them, this paper suggests that each LOD should prepare a link policy and publish it together with the LOD. The link policy specifies target LODs, predicate pairs, and similarity degrees to decide on the establishment of links. We have implemented a system that performs in-depth searching through LODs using their link policies. We have published APIs of the system to Github. Results of the experiment on the in-depth searching system with similarity degrees of 1.0 ~ 0.8 and depth level of 4 provides searching results that include 91% ~ 98% of the trustworthy links and about 170% of triples expanded.
